La Liga Santander Bellingham’s late goal seals El Clasico comeback win for Real Madrid

Real Madrid again gave their fans an evening to remember at the Santiago Bernabeu with a comeback in El Clasico on Sunday.

After advancing to the semi-finals of Champions League in Manchester, Ancelotti’s men once again drew on their DNA and turned around a game in which they were behind twice.

Goals from Vini Jr, Lucas Vazquez and Bellingham in the 91st minute secured the win for our team, increasing their lead over the blaugranas to 11 points with six games left to play in La Liga.Barcelona went ahead early on when Christensen headed in Rapinha’s corner (6′).

Madrid’s reaction came soon after, coming close to making it 1-1 two minutes later. Tchouameni put a lofted pass into the box, Modric headed wide and Vini Jr’s right-footed effort failed to find the target. The Brazilian came up with another chance soon after. This time it was with a deflected header from a Kroos free-kick.

Madrid were searching for an equalizer and, in the 18th minute, they got it. Lucas Vazquez drove to the byline, dribbled past Cancelo and was brought down by Cubarsi. The penalty was then converted by Vini Jr. to make it 1-1. The Catalans responded again from another corner (28′). Lamine Yamal whipped in an outswinging corner, Lunin cleared the ball off the line and the VAR, after a review, ruled that the ball hadn’t crossed the goal line.

Modric had the last chance of the first half following some nice link-up play between Rodrygo, Bellingham, Valverde on the edge of the area. The Croatian’s shot from inside the box was saved by Ter Stegen.
